Pool clarifying agents are essential tools for maintaining crystal clear pool water. These clarifiers function by clumping small particles together that cause cloudiness, allowing the filter to remove them. This results in dramatically clearer water, enhancing the overall swimming experience.
- Improved Water Clarity: A major advantage of pool water clarifiers is improved water clarity. Clarifiers bind together small particles such as dirt, oil, and organic matter, that normally pass through the filter. After aggregation, these particles can be caught by the filter, resulting in visibly clearer water. This not only makes the pool more attractive, but also signifies healthier water quality.
- Enhanced Filtration Efficiency: Water clarifiers for pools can increase the effectiveness of your pool filter. By binding small particles into larger clumps, clarifiers allow the filter to capture more debris. This means your filter works more efficiently, prolonging its lifespan and reducing the need for frequent maintenance. Increased filter effectiveness also ensures better water circulation, which is vital for proper chemical balance and overall pool wellness.

Varieties of Pool Water ClarifiersSeveral types of pool clarifiers are available, each catering to different needs. Understanding these can assist you in picking the right one for your pool.
- Polymer-Based Clarifiers: Polymeric pool clarifiers use long-chain molecules to bind small particles together. These clarifiers are extremely effective and work quickly to improve water clarity. They are perfect for routine maintenance and can be applied weekly.
- Enzyme-Based Clarifiers: Enzyme-based clarifiers use biological enzymes to decompose organic matter. These clarifiers are environmentally safe and are ideal for pools with high organic loads. They not only clear the water, but also decrease the load on the filtration system.
- Pool Flocculants: Pool flocculants work by causing small particles to coagulate into larger masses, which then sink to the bottom of the pool. These particles can then be vacuumed away, leaving the water crystal clear. Flocculants are particularly useful for dealing with severe cloudiness, but they necessitate manual vacuuming following application.
